The online submission of documents for admission under Right to Education (RTE) Act is expected to be completed by March 13. However, barely 10 days away from the deadline, complaints have been pouring in from parents about the process.

Parents claim they were waiting outside the Chembur help centre for an hour, only to be told that there was no staff to help them
